Wife of US evangelist Billy Graham dies
0 Comments | AFP, June, 2007
MIAMI (AFP) — Ruth Graham, the wife of prominent evangelist Billy Graham, died on Thursday at her home in North Carolina, her husband said. She was 87.
She had slipped into a coma after months of illness, and when she died she was surrounded by her husband and their five children.
"Ruth was my life partner, and we were called by God as a team," said Graham, 88, according to a statement.
"No one else could have borne the load that she carried. She was a vital and integral part of our ministry, and my work through the years would have been impossible without her encouragement and support."
"I will miss her terribly, and look forward even more to the day I can join her in heaven," he said.
